One best thing about these Kinco gloves? It’s thermal Insulation!

It has a fantastic Heatkeep Thermal Lining!

The lining comprises finely spun polyester fibers that trap heat and resist cold by creating millions of air pockets around the hand.

The fact that it is made of pigskin is also a plus. Leather is durable, breedable, and pliable. It is extremely abrasion-resistant and long-lasting. Pigskin leather also resists tightening when exposed to moisture.

Apart from that…

The wing-thumb design is my favorite feature of this product. An angled thumb with no seam between the palm and thumb that allows for left-right movement.

Buyer Guide: How To Choose The Best Bushcraft Gloves

Best Bushcraft Gloves - Bugoutbill.com
  • Save

Different Types Gloves

Leather Work Gloves

A good leather glove is a favorite bushcraft gloves choice among bushcrafters because they are durable, thick, water-resistant, and give excellent protection against scratches and other possible threats to your hands.

Mechanic Gloves

Mechanic Gloves are often heavy and padded, yet they still provide a decent grip, making them a choice for bushcraft. One disadvantage of mechanic gloves is that they rarely have insulation, so you’ll mostly use them in hot weather, and they won’t be perfect for fine motor skills like knot tying.

Tactical Gloves

Tactical gloves are yet another popular option for bushcraft and survival situations. They’re usually cushioned, waterproof, and have good dexterity.

Nitrile Work Gloves

Nitrile Work Gloves are a good general-purpose glove for bushcraft because they give excellent protection without compromising dexterity or hand movement.

Things to Consider and Features to Look out for before buying Bushcraft Gloves

Grip

The top bushcraft gloves must keep your grip. Look for gloves with a textured, rough, or tacky surface on the palms to keep things from slipping out of your hands as you grip them.

Protection

Because you’ll be working with wood and other natural materials, as well as knives and other sharp tools, your gloves should protect you from cuts and scrapes.

Apart from that…

Gloves should be thick enough to protect your hands from potential hazards and should completely cover your hands.

Strength and Durability

You’ll need a pair of high-quality bushcraft gloves that are rated for durability. Gloves are available in a range of materials. You want sturdy and durable gloves enough to survive the wear and tear that bushcraft puts them through.

Also…

A solid blend of rough sturdiness and flexible dexterity is frequently what produces the greatest bushcraft gloves. 

With this…

You’re onto a winner if you can get enough protection on the important areas of your hands without sacrificing your ability to utilize your fingers properly.

Warmth

If you’re going outside during the winter or if your place is in cold weather, you’ll need insulating gloves to keep your hands warm. Look for gloves that have enough space in them to “trap” air.

Also, think about cuff length because you’ll want to keep the snow away from your skin in some cases. I would suggest wearing an additional thin pair for increased warmth if you’re not satisfied with the warmth your gloves have.

Water-Resistant

Most bushcraft gloves do not come with waterproofing, as you can see. This isn’t a major disadvantage because you can waterproof leather gloves using a snow seal/waterproofing wax.

You’ll want bushcraft gloves that are water-resistant or waterproof if you’ll be practicing bushcraft in the rain, rainy circumstances, or cold weather.

Frequently Asked Questions

Best Bushcraft Gloves - Bugoutbill.com
  • Save

Question 1: What makes bushcraft gloves different?

A - A Bushcraft gloves are designed to protect your hands first. Thus not all gloves will work. A solid blend of rough sturdiness and flexible dexterity is frequently what makes the top bushcraft gloves.

Question 2: What types of gloves can you use for bushcraft?

A - A Leather work gloves, mechanics gloves, gardening gloves, and safety gloves are just a few examples of outdoor work gloves you can use for bushcraft.

Question 3: What are the types of gloves to avoid for bushcraft?

A - A Avoid using ski or cotton gloves when conducting bushcraft. Ski gloves provide minor benefits because you have limited dexterity and durability, and cotton gloves are typically too thin to provide adequate hand protection and are prone to tearing.
